One day agreement
The Salafi freezed the agreement with Hizballah.
Sheikh Hassan Shahhal, who signed the understanding on Monday with Hizbullah’s Ibrahim Amin al-Sayyed, declared freezing the agreement pending “appropriate circumstances that allow its implementation.”
Sheikh Hassan made the announcement after a meeting with leaders of Salafi factions presided over by their highest authority Dai al-Islam al-Shahhal who had rushed to denounce and criticize the deal with Hizbullah, minutes after it was announced on Monday. [Naharnet]
This must be the shortest ever PR stunt of Hizballah. Maybe tomorrow they will sign another agreement with the Salafi or with others. In Lebanon not everything is logic, although everything has some sort of justification.
Jamaa Islamyya, the Muslim Brotherhood branch in Lebanon through the voice of Sheikh Faisal Mallawi declared that Hizballah is in a state of “real sedition with most of the Lebanese, especially the Sunni Muslims.”[Naharnet]
“Hizbullah should go into serious and objective dialogue with authorities and effective factions so that mistakes committed by both sides would be clearly stated and defined to avoid committing them anew.”
